v1.4.0 — Deploybeak chat bot. New: rollback status now posts to the release channel automatically. Slash command responses include environment and commit summary. Fixed duplicate notifications on retried deploys. New team members: pairing docs are in the onboarding wiki. Report any bot misbehavior to the maintainer named below.

signatory, fafog-bagef: Jorwyn Juleth Pelius

## Deploying SquatSniff

SquatSniff watches package registries for names a keystroke away from yours and flags lookalikes before anyone installs them. Deployment is a single container plus a small state volume; it polls registries, scores candidates with edit-distance and homoglyph checks, and posts alerts to whatever webhook you give it. Run it somewhere with outbound access to the registries and nothing else — it needs no inbound ports. Heads up for review: thresholds are tunable. The defaults we ship are shown below.

settings of bawif-fawif:
ralix:
  log_level: warn
  metrics_host: metrics.ralix.tolvaqsys.internal
  pool_size: 32

- [ ] Step 7: Archive cold storage buckets (Glacierline tier). Confirm both ceremony witnesses are present, verify bucket manifests match the Oxbow ledger, then seal the archive key shares. Plugin authors may observe but not handle shares. Once sealed, the archive index itself is encrypted and can only be reopened with the passphrase below.

vault phrase of badup-hahig = tamael-aldael-kelmir-istael-fenok-istwyn-tamius-jorath-oliion

Handover note — Crumbwheel order cutoffs.

Welcome aboard. The bakery cutoff rule in Crumbwheel closes same-day orders at 14:00 local to each storefront, not UTC — this has bitten us twice. Holiday overrides live in the calendar service and take precedence silently, so always check there first when a cutoff looks wrong. To unlock the calendar service's admin console after a restart, enter the recovery passphrase below.

vault phrase of bagap-bahaf = silion-pelox-sorox-casdor-quenwyn-fraax-eliox-praael-kelion-quenvan-kasox-rusael-norius-belvan